Specifications
Frequency Stability: ±50ppm
Current - Supply (Disable) (Max): 4.1mA
Height - Seated (Max): 0.032" (0.80mm)
Size / Dimension: 0.197" L x 0.126" W (5.00mm x 3.20mm)
Package / Case: 4-SMD, No Lead
Mounting Type: Surface Mount
Ratings: --
Current - Supply (Max): 4.5mA
Operating Temperature: -55°C ~ 125°C
Series: SiT8920
Voltage - Supply: 3.3V
Output: LVCMOS, LVTTL
Function: Enable/Disable
Frequency: 30MHz
Type: XO (Standard)
Base Resonator: MEMS
Part Status: Not For New Designs
Packaging: Tape & Reel (TR)
